### v3.2.0 — Renamed setting

Keyspindle no longer reads `KS_ROTATE_TOKEN`; it was renamed for consistency with the plugin API. Plugins targeting 3.2+ must use the new name or rotation hooks will not fire. The old name is ignored silently — no deprecation warning is emitted. Update your `.env` before upgrading. Keep `KS_PLUGIN_DIR` and `KS_LOG_LEVEL` as-is. Immediately after those entries, add the renamed token line with your existing value.

secret setting of kawif-kajef: COURIER_KEY3=d2b

Document Transport — Sealed-Bid Tenders

Sealed-bid envelopes for the Ostreve Bridge tender are treated as controlled documents. Dispatch must book a single-rider courier, log the seal number, and keep the envelope in the locked pouch for the full route. No photocopies, no transfers between riders. The hand-over at the tender office follows the confidential instruction below.

dispatch memo: the eliok quenok courier leaves the sorael aldath belion tammir casix gileth queniel jorath ledger at gate 9299 under passcode 897989

# Break-Glass: Catalog Cache Invalidation

Scope: the Pinrow product catalog at Veldstone Retail. If stale prices persist after a purge and the Hollowmere invalidation queue is wedged, use break-glass to flush the edge tier directly. Contractors: get verbal sign-off from the catalog lead first. Steps: open the Hollowmere admin shell, select emergency-flush, confirm the tenant, and run it once — repeated flushes thrash the origin. Access is logged and expires after 20 minutes. Unseal the admin shell with the passphrase below.

recovery phrase for kahop-tajog: istix-casvan

Migrating cron jobs off the Harwick scheduler box to Flowspire. Export each crontab entry, wrap it in a Flowspire task spec, set retries to 3, and disable the original only after two clean runs. Do not delete crontabs until the quarterly audit passes. Janek owns the cutover sheet. When verifying a migrated job, compare against the token recorded below.

pipeline stamp: htk9_ce63042d9